Molly Laverne Wadel, 81, of Kearneysville, passed away Friday, August 13, 2021, at her home, while surrounded by her loving family and under the care of Hospice. Born August 3, 1940, in Prince William County, Virginia, she was the daughter of the late Clyde Roland Anderson and Amanda Able.
She retired from the Prince William County, Virginia public school system, where she had worked as a cafeteria manager.
She is survived by her three sons: Clyde Wadel, of Brandy Station, Virginia, Troy Wadel, and wife Dorothy, of Midland, Virginia, and David Wadel, of Manassas, Virginia; daughter, Teresa Walker, and husband Dale, of Kearneysville; two sisters: Brenda Riffle, of Flint, Michigan, and Juanita Staples, and husband Russ, of Nelson, Virginia; seven grandchildren and eight great grandchildren.
In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her husband, Sam Levi Wadel; son, Sammy Wadel, Jr.; three brothers and one sister.
